1783 girl students get Bank ATM cards under 'Pudhumai Penn' scheme in Tirupur

The second phase of “Pudhumai Penn” under which Rs.1000 monthly stipend to women pursuing higher education is being extended is launched today. District Collector Vineeth distributed bank ATM cards to 1783 students.



Tirupur: On behalf of the Government of Tamil Nadu, a novel scheme under which Rs.1000 monthly stipend to the women pursuing higher education is being given is launched today.

The scheme known as “Pudhumai Penn” under Moovalur Ramamirtham Ammaiyar Higher Education Guarantee Scheme would benefit young women doing higher studies.



An amount of 1,000 per month would be deposited in the student’s bank accounts till they complete their studies.



Today, ATM cards for the same have been issuedWhile, 3,657 girls from 40 colleges in Tiruppur district were issued ATM cards under the scheme in 2022-23, In the second phase, 1,783 girls from 49 colleges were issued ATM cards under the scheme.



District collector Vineeth, Deputy Mayor Balasubramaniyam and others participated in the programme and When a student of a first-year government college complained to the district collector that there was a problem in linking the Aadhaar number to the bank account opened under the scheme, the District Collector Vineeth checked it on his mobile phone and promised to resolve the issue immediately.
